/* TABLE 1 */
	/* GENERALE */

	/* SORTING */
	.sorting_asc {
	   background: url('../../image/icons/16/sort_asc.png') no-repeat center right;
	}
	.sorting_desc {
	   background: url('../../image/icons/16/sort_desc.png') no-repeat center right;
	}
	.sorting {
	   background: url('../../image/icons/16/sort_both.png') no-repeat center right;
	}
	.sorting_asc_disabled {
	   background: url('../../image/icons/16/sort_asc_disabled.png') no-repeat center right;
	}
	.sorting_desc_disabled {
	   background: url('../../image/icons/16/sort_desc_disabled.png') no-repeat center right;
	}

	/* INFORMAZIONI */	
	.dataTables_info {
	   width: 60%;
	   float: left;
	}

	/* HEAD */
	.table_gen thead tr {
	   color: #FFFFFF;
	   cursor: pointer;
	   background-color: #6AA8BA;
	}


	/* ROWS */
	.table_gen tbody tr.even {
	   color: #333333;
	   background-color: #CFD8FC;
	}

	.table_gen tbody tr.odd {
	   color: #333333;
	   background-color: #EFF1FC;
	}

	/* HIGHLIGHT */
	.table_gen tbody tr.even:hover {
	   cursor: pointer;
	   color: #CCCCCC;
	   background-color: #333333;
	}

	.table_gen tbody tr.odd:hover {
	   cursor: pointer;
	   color: #CCCCCC;
	   background-color: #333333;
	}

	/* PAGINAZIONE */
	.paging_full_numbers span.paginate_button,
 	   .paging_full_numbers span.paginate_active {
	      border: 1px solid #aaa;
	      -webkit-border-radius: 5px;
	      -moz-border-radius: 5px;
	      padding: 2px 5px;
	      margin: 0 3px;
	      cursor: pointer;
	      *cursor: hand;
	}
	
	.paging_full_numbers span.paginate_button {
	   background-color: #EDF8FB;
	}

	.paging_full_numbers span.paginate_button:hover {
	   background-color: #DDCEFC;
	}

	.paging_full_numbers span.paginate_active {
	   background-color: #7BAFBE;
	}
